Ulsan is a key industrial and logistics hub in South Korea, featuring a developed transport infrastructure. The city has a major port, one of the busiest in the country, facilitating rapid cargo handling. Major international airports are located in nearby Seoul and Busan, providing accessible delivery flights. Rail hubs connect Ulsan with major cities across the country, ensuring an efficient distribution network. Typical delivery times for parcels from abroad range from 3 to 7 days, depending on the country of origin and delivery type. Ulsan is also known for its effective customs control system, which aids in the swift processing of international shipments.
